Ever since she revealed that she had been diagnosed with breast cancer, Bravo fans have been wondering where Guerdy’s cancer journey is now on The Real Housewives of Miami and if her health is OK. Guerdy Abraira joined The Real Housewives of Miami, Bravo’s reality TV series following the personal and professional lives of wealthy women living in Miami, Florida, in Season 4.

The series—which is a part of Bravo’s Real Housewives franchise featuring 11 cities across the world—premiered in 2011 and was canceled in 2013. It was rebooted by Peacock, NBC Universal’s streaming service, in 2021 after almost a decade off the air. The Real Housewives of Miami moved from Peacock to Bravo in 2023 in Season 6, which premiered in November 2023. Geurdy was one of four new cast members for the reboot, along with Julia Lemigova, Nicole Martin, and Kiki Barth.

Guerdy revealed in an Instagram post in May 2023 that she had been diagnosed with breast cancer. “In March, I found out some news about my health. I was in St. Barts having the time of my life when my doctor called me with results following a regular mammogram checkup,” she said. “I have breast cancer. It took me a while to process it all and this is why I took a break from social media last month as many noticed. Many of you reached out to check on me and I am thankful for your caring gestures.”

She continued, “For now I am preparing for my upcoming surgery and then will come my treatment plan. This process is definitely intense and what I ask of yuo is empowerment not pity. I will ‘guerdyfy’ this cancer as I guerdyfy everything else in my life. I am lucky that this breast cancer was discovered at an early stage. It is still scary of course, but I have love and support from those around me and that alone is the fuel that I need. For those who do not get health checks regularly, I urge you to. Your life depends on it.”

Does Guerdy still have cancer from The Real Housewives of Miami?

Does Guerdy still have cancer from The Real Housewives of Miami? The answer is no. Guerdy Abraira revealed at The Real Housewives of Miami at BravoCon 2023 in November that she was cancer-free. “I’m cancer-free officially! I’m about to the ring the radiation bell on Wednesday. I’m a little itchy down here, but we made it work. I’m very excited. I’m so blessed. I literally wake up every morning counting my blessings and making it count. Remember that: Make it count,” she said.

Guerdy also People at the time that BravoCon was her “final hooray at the end of the tunnel.” “I have two more radiation rounds,” she said. “So like getting into these rooms [at BravoCon], meeting the fans and them saying ‘You are that hero’ — or she-ro — it’s incredible.”

Guerdy revealed that she learned she was cancer-free while “living it up in” in St. Barts on vacation and started “sobbing” when she received the good news. “That’s what life is. It’s ups and downs,” she said. “You never know when you’re gonna go down and you never know when you’re gonna go up. And today is my up day. My up life is now, back to normal-ish. And I wanna keep it that way.”

She also credited her husband, Russell Abraira, for caring for her throughout her cancer journey. “I just don’t even know how he did it because no one saw it coming and here comes cancer knocking at your door, and you don’t know if you’re going to make it,” she said. “He’s the best caretaker that I could have asked for. And not only that, but he’s also very good-looking.”

She continued, “He was a good nurse. But, you know, it really shows how nothing matters in life except for family and love and support and your health.”

During The Real Housewives of Miami panel at BravoCon, Guerdy also explained why she wanted to show her cancer journey on reality TV. “I was told I know I was going to be treated and I’ll be OK eventually but we were gonna go through a hard time. And to me, I said to myself, ‘If I can show the good and the bad, then it’s only better,’” she said.

She continued, “A lot of people with cancer, they feel like they have the plague and they don’t want to share and they feel like something’s wrong with them and they go into hiding. And I said to myself, ‘I’m not doing that. I’m not going out like that.’”
